timber carriers (grapples, pincers, ... Furnishings and Equipment (hierarchy name)) |
|
Note: Devices for carrying lightweight tree trunks, telephone poles and similar. The version designed for two persons consists of a pair of hinged chisel-bill hooks used as pincers mounted on pivots at the middle of a wooden pole, which is grasped at either side of the object being carried. The weight of the log forces the hooks to sink into the wood. There are verions for single-person operation with a number of interconnected levers between handle and hooks and is used for carrying relatively short pieces. |

Additional Notes: |
|
Dutch ..... Werktuig om betrekkelijk lichte boomstammen, telefoonpalen, e.d. te dragen of te slepen. De houtdraaghaak voor twee man bestaat uit twee naar elkaar scharnierende metalen haken die in het midden van een houten stok (ca. 100-150 cm) bevestigd zijn. Vaak kunnen de haken ook roteren. De stok wordt door twee man gevat die aan beide zijden van de stam lopen. Door het gewicht steken de punten in het hout. De stok moet ca. één meter langer zijn dan de middenlijn van de stammen om te vermijden dat de benen van de dragers ertegen zouden wrijven. De houtdraaghaak voor één man is een klein werktuig (ca. 30 cm) met een aantal op elkaar werkende hefbomen tussen handvat en haken (ca. 10 cm). Het wordt door één man bediend en wordt gebruikt om betrekkelijk korte stukken te dragen. |
